Noting the #1 Crimson Tide
No. 1 Alabama (44-3, 23-2 SEC) went a perfect 5-0 against SEC competition this past week with an amazing five straight shutouts ... Alabama has reeled off 23 consecutive wins overall and has a 20-game winning streak in SEC play ... the Crimson Tide also got a chance to play the U.S. Olympic Team and former UA star Kelly Kretschman in an exhibition game at Liberty Park in Vestavia Hills, Ala., on Tuesday night ... the five consecutive shutouts are the second-most in school history and the most in a single season by UA against SEC competition ... Alabama took over the No. 1 spot in the USA Today/NFCA poll on Tuesday, April 15, while moving up to No. 2 in the ESPN.com/USA Softball poll ... junior center fielder Brittany Rogers became the Tide's all-time leading base stealer on Sunday against South Carolina as she swiped her 134th-career base, passing Kretschman (1998-2001) ... Rogers also tied her own single-season record on Sunday with her 48th steal of the year ... the Alabama pitching staff was spectacular with five complete-game shutouts to their credit this past week ... the pitching staff struck out 39 and walked just four while holding opponents to a .107 batting average ... Kelsi Dunne and Charlotte Morgan both notched two complete-game shutouts while Chrissy Owens finished things off in style on Sunday with a nine-strikeout, three-hit, complete-game shutout of her own ... at the plate, Kelley Montalvo posted a .533 batting average with four runs scored, three doubles, a triple and five RBI ... she reached base at a .588 clip and slugged .867 ... Morgan continued her power display with two home runs and seven RBI ... she narrowly missed out on another home run when Montalvo was called out ahead of the home run for leaving base early ... Morgan has 59 RBI this season, which ranks tied with Jackie McClain for the fourth most in a single season in UA history ... Kellie Eubanks also had a big week with a .417 batting average and four RBI ... Rogers stole five bases and Whitney Larsen hit .385 with four RBI ... Alabama's 94 doubles as a team are one shy of tying the school record set in 2005 ... UA finished off a seven-game road swing with a doubleheader sweep of Arkansas in Fayetteville Thursday ... Eubanks cracked a three-run home run in the seventh inning in the opener to give the Tide a comfortable 4-0 win as Dunne hurled her first complete game of the week ... Morgan then stifled the Razorback offense in the second game, allowing just two hits and striking out a season-high seven ... Morgan and Rogers paced the dangerous Tide offense in the opening game against South Carolina ... Morgan hit her 13th home run of the season to end the game with an 8-0 run rule as Dunne notched another complete game ... Morgan then went to work in the circle in game two of the doubleheader, allowing just three hits while also driving in two runs at the plate ... Morgan homered again in the series finale as Owens controlled USC in the circle with nine strikeouts.
Pitcher/Freshman of the Week Nominee
Kelsi Dunne * Freshman * P
Port Orange, Fla. / Spruce Creek HS
Kelsi Dunne pitched two complete-game shutouts in her two starts this week and allowed just three hits. She struck out 20 over 13 innings and held opponents to a 0.75 batting average. Dunne began the week with a two-hit complete-game win at Arkansas where she fanned. She then one-hit South Carolina on Saturday, striking out 10 Gamecocks in an 8-0 win in six innings. Dunne has not allowed a run over her last 14 innings of work in the circle. She improved to 18-3 with a 1.36 ERA and 192 strikeouts in 138.2 innings this season.
Player of the Week Nominee
Kelley Montalvo * Junior * 3B
Miami, Fla. / Pace HS
Kelley Montalvo led the Crimson Tide offense in five wins this week and a .533 batting average. She ripped three doubles and a triple while driving in five runs and posting a .588 on-base percentage. Montalvo hit in all five games with three multiple-hit games. She was 1 for 3 in both games at Arkansas with a RBI in a 3-0 win in the nightcap of the doubleheader. Montalvo had multiple hits in all three games of the South Carolina series, hitting .667 (6 for 9) against Gamecock pitching with four RBI. She had a triple and two RBI in the series opener and ripped two doubles in the final game of the series as the Tide completed the sweep.
